Allaire State Park is widely celebrated for its diverse landscape, including dense forests, the winding Manasquan River, and its renowned Historic Village at Allaire. The "Family Campsites" are strategically situated within this scenic park, offering campers a chance to disconnect from urban life and reconnect with nature. Whether you're a seasoned camper with an RV, a family looking to introduce kids to tent camping, or prefer the rustic comfort of a cabin-like shelter, Allaire provides options to suit different preferences and levels of outdoor enthusiasm. The focus here is on providing a family-friendly environment where comfort, safety, and a wide array of activities ensure a memorable stay for all ages.

The allure of "Family Campsites" at Allaire is significantly enhanced by the park's unique features. Beyond the well-maintained campsites, visitors have direct access to miles of scenic hiking and multi-use trails, opportunities for freshwater fishing, and the charming Historic Allaire Village. This living history museum transports visitors back to the 19th century, with operational blacksmith, bakery, and carpentry shops, offering an educational and entertaining dimension to the camping trip. The Pine Creek Railroad, a narrow-gauge train ride, further adds to the park's appeal, especially for families with children. For those traveling by car, Allaire State Park is conveniently located near major roadways. Route 195 (Exit 31) provides direct access from the New Jersey Turnpike (Exit 7A) and the Garden State Parkway (Exit 98). This makes the campground easily reachable from Northern, Central, and Southern New Jersey. Routes 33, 34, and 524 also offer straightforward routes into the Farmingdale area. The relative proximity to the Jersey Shore (Spring Lake, Point Pleasant Beach) also means a beach day can be a quick side trip from your campsite.

Once inside Allaire State Park, the campground is situated in the northwestern portion, approximately one mile west of the Historic Allaire Village. The park's internal roads are well-maintained, leading directly to the camping areas and shelters. While the gate does lock at night (typically 8:00 p.m.), ensuring a secure and quiet environment, campers should plan their arrivals and departures accordingly. The park office is open daily to assist with check-ins and inquiries. Services Offered (as part of Allaire State Park's Campground):

  • Campsite Options: Offers 45 tent and trailer sites, each equipped with a picnic table and a fire ring. Sites are available for both tents and RVs (though no water/electric/sewer connections for RVs directly at sites).
  • Shelter Rentals: Ten cabin-like shelters are available, each with a wood stove for heat, two double-deck bunks (sleeping up to four people), a fire ring, and a picnic table. Some are ADA accessible.
  • Modern Restroom Facilities: Clean flush toilets and hot showers are within walking distance of all campsites and shelters.
  • Drinking Water: Water spigots are available throughout the campground.
  • RV Dump Station: A trailer sanitary dump station is available (open mid-April through mid-October).
  • Group Camping: Separate group campsites are available in the southern portion of the park, suitable for larger organized groups.
  • Firewood Sales: Firewood is typically available for purchase at the campground office.
  • Picnic Areas: Dedicated picnic facilities with charcoal grills and tables are provided within the park for day use.
  • Children's Playground: A small kids' playground is located within the campground area, with additional playgrounds in the wider park.
  • Online Reservation System: Campsite and shelter reservations can be made online via the New Jersey State Parks reservation system.
  • Park Ranger Assistance: On-site park rangers provide support and ensure adherence to park rules.

Features and Highlights of Family Campsites at Allaire State Park:

  • Wooded Campsites: The majority of sites are wooded, providing natural shade, privacy, and an immersive outdoor experience.
  • Historic Allaire Village: Uniquely, the campground is part of Allaire State Park, which includes a restored 19th-century industrial village offering educational programs, demonstrations, and shops (bakery, blacksmith, etc.).
  • Pine Creek Railroad: A narrow-gauge train ride within the park, a popular attraction for families.
  • Extensive Trail System: Miles of marked hiking and multi-use trails (for hiking, bicycling, equestrian use) wind through diverse terrain, including wetlands and forests along the Manasquan River.
  • Freshwater Fishing: The Manasquan River, which bisects the park, offers excellent opportunities for freshwater fishing (trout stocked annually).
  • Manasquan River Access: Provides unique habitat for diverse flora and fauna, making it a great spot for nature observation and bird watching.
  • Variety of Activities: Beyond camping, visitors can enjoy disc golf, picnicking, and exploring the Nature Interpretive Center.

Promotions or Special Offers:

As a New Jersey State Park facility, "Family Campsites" at Allaire State Park typically offers value through its standard, affordable rates for residents, rather than frequent, short-term promotional discounts. However, there are inherent benefits and structured pricing that serve as offers for locals:

  • New Jersey Resident Rates: NJ residents often pay a lower nightly rate for campsites and shelters compared to non-residents (e.g., as of recent schedules, campsites might be $20/night for residents vs. $25/night for non-residents; shelters $48/night for residents vs. $60/night for non-residents). This built-in discount is a significant "special offer" for local users.
  • Seasonal Availability: Campsites and shelters are open for extended seasons (typically April 1 to December 15), providing ample opportunities to visit outside of peak summer crowds when pricing remains consistent.
  • Value of Park Access: The camping fee grants full access to all the features of Allaire State Park, including the Historic Village (though specific tours or train rides may have separate fees), trails, and fishing opportunities, providing substantial value for the camping price.
  • Group Site Options: Specific group campsites are available at set rates, providing an affordable option for larger family or community gatherings.
